What do you learn about relapse prevention while in Greensboro Drug Treatment and Alcohol Rehab Facilities? Drug Treatment and Alcohol Rehab Facility Relapse Prevention Tips:

Exercise: It sounds simple, and it is. It is proven to work for people who are quitting smoking and smoking is one of the strongest addictions there are. Take a walk around the block or do some other simple exercise.

Socialize: With NEW people! Going back to the people you hung out with to do drugs is almost certainly going to lead you to a relapse. Go to some public events and meet some new people.

Change your environment: This can take on several different levels. You can start by rearranging your furniture and fixing the place up. You also need to change the environment where you spend a lot of time. Don't go back to the old places where the urge to do drugs may be too strong. Try going to some new places and doing new things. Go to a ballgame or to a museum or even a movie.

Minimize Boredom: Boredom is never a good thing. Chances are, if you get bored, it will increase the chances that you will get an urge for drugs. Take up doing crossword puzzles or other games, for example. Keeping yourself busy will help prevent drug addiction relapse.

Eat Better: No one expects you to change every aspect of your diet. It would be wise to throw in a few more fruits and vegetables. Maybe you could drink a couple more glasses of water a day. You may be amazed at how good it can make you feel.

Get Close to People: No need to go out on a hug-fest but let people in. Build strong and healthy relationships with people who are not drug addicts. Get a Mentor: They help you through the rough times and they understand what you are going through. They can be real lifesavers when the urges for drugs or alcohol become overwhelming.

Believe in yourself: Poor self-esteem may very well be what leads people into drug addiction in the first place. Have faith in yourself and don't put yourself down. You are on the right road and doing the right thing.

Relapse prevention is critical for the addict to remain clean once they have left the Greensboro Alcohol Rehabilitation and Drug Treatment Facility. Recovery is an ongoing process. The skills one learns during an intensive stay at a Drug Treatment and Alcohol Rehab Facility in Greensboro must be integrated into everyday life and this takes time. Though there are a variety of different types of Drug Rehabilitation and Alcohol Rehabs available, all include strategies for keeping the person in treatment, skills to help the individual handle everyday situations that may cause trouble once they have completed the drug or alcohol rehab and guidance and counseling towards understanding the individual's initial reasons for drug addiction.

Generally, the more Greensboro drug treatment an individual receives the better the outcome. Those who stay in a Drug Rehab and Alcohol Treatment Facility longer than three months often have better outcomes than those who stay less time. Over the last 25 years, studies have shown that Alcohol Rehabilitation and Drug Treatment Programs work to reduce an individual's drug use, relapse rate as well as crimes committed by drug addicted individuals.
